Raffles Montessori Int. School Responds to Allegations
Phnom Penh, Cambodia: A couple weeks ago, there were a few pictures of a naked boy with some red marks on his bottom posted and shared on Facebook. It’s believed that he was beaten up by his teacher at RAFFLES MONTESSORI International School of Phnom Penh. According to that source, it’s believed that the boy was brought by his teacher to the toilet where he later was beaten up.
In response to that accusation on Facebook that accused the teacher of RAFFLES MONTESSORI International School of Phnom Penh beating the student in the bathroom, the school has issued a few letters and posted on Facebook to confirm that it was not true.
Raffles Montessori International School of Phnom Penh is an International school which was recognized by Raffles Montessori Singapore and has the same standards with the Raffles Montessori School Singapore.
All teachers at Raffles Montessori are native speakers of English and all the teaching assistants and babysitters were trained in pedagogy. Everywhere in the school building is equipped with security cameras to assure the security of the students.
